
The AirTAC Airtac SC80 Standard Cylinder SC80X670S is a genuine double-acting standard air cylinder with a Ø80mm bore and 670mm stroke, PT3/8 air ports and adjustable end cushioning. It is used for push, pull, lift and clamp motion in industrial automation.
The AirTAC SC80X670S is a double-acting tie-rod cylinder with an 80 mm bore and a 670 mm stroke, delivering a push force of 2513 N at 0.5 MPa (4523 N at 0.9 MPa). Its 25 mm diameter piston rod and 28 mm adjustable air cushion provide smooth deceleration for mid-to-heavy linear motion tasks.
The built-in magnet (-S suffix) allows direct mounting of CMSG/DMSG/EMSG reed or solid-state sensors on the barrel for contactless position sensing. With a body length A of 182 mm and PT3/8 ports, this cylinder is a genuine AirTAC unit designed for reliable pneumatic automation.

Actual usable force is lower than theoretical due to friction and back-pressure. Size with a safety margin.

The 670 mm stroke and 2513 N push force reliably actuate diverter gates on wide conveyor lines, with the built-in magnet enabling end-of-stroke confirmation via barrel-mounted sensors.
Delivers consistent clamping force for large workpieces. The adjustable cushion protects tooling from impact shock, while the -S magnet provides closed-loop position feedback.
Handles the long reach required to push or lift layers onto pallets. The 25 mm rod and tie-rod construction offer rigidity for repetitive, high-cycle stacking operations.
This 80 mm bore model suits applications needing around 2500 N of force. If your load is lighter, stepping down to a 63 mm bore (1559 N at 0.5 MPa) can reduce air consumption and cost. For heavier demands, the 100 mm bore provides 3927 N at the same pressure.
At 670 mm stroke, ensure the rod is guided externally if significant side loads are present, as long unsupported strokes can cause rod bending and seal wear. For replacement, match bore, stroke, PT3/8 port thread, the built-in magnet (-S), and your mounting accessory to guarantee drop-in interchangeability with an existing AirTAC SC80 cylinder.
